CN-224228252-U - Detachable post-pouring strip plugging structure
Abstract
The utility model relates to a detachable post-pouring strip plugging structure, steel wire meshes are arranged on two sides in a post-pouring strip area, a template is arranged on one side of the steel wire meshes, square timber is arranged on the outer side of the upper end of the template and above the steel wire meshes, steel plates are arranged above the square timber and the template, handles are arranged on the upper surfaces of the steel plates, and the handles and the steel plates are fixed through screws and are integrated. The utility model has the advantages of integrated structure, detachability, repeated recycling, reduced time for reinstallation and improved construction efficiency. Detachable post-pouring strip plugging structure Technical Field The utility model belongs to the technical field of post-pouring belts for building construction, and particularly relates to a detachable post-pouring belt plugging structure. Background In the building construction process, the post-cast strip plugging is usually performed in a mode of welding a steel reinforcement framework to bind a steel wire mesh and a mode of template plugging, and a large amount of labor is consumed for removing in the later period of the two methods. The construction process overelaborate adopting the form of binding the steel wire mesh by the welded steel reinforcement framework is time-consuming, more steel bars are exposed, meanwhile, the conditions of uneven stay and siltation, uneven spreading, untight plugging and the like of the steel wire mesh often occur, so that the problems of concrete pouring swelling and slurry leakage, difficult post-pouring belt cleaning, poor quality after pouring and the like are caused, and the templates in the template plugging can only be used once in most cases, so that the material resource waste is serious. Disclosure of utility model The utility model aims to solve the problems, and provides a detachable post-pouring strip plugging structure, square timber is arranged above a steel wire mesh and a template, when concrete is poured in a post-pouring strip area, the side surface is smooth, and steel plates are arranged above the template and the square timber, so that sundries are prevented from falling in the construction process, constructors can walk conveniently, the detachable post-pouring strip plugging structure is of a detachable integrated structure, the post-pouring strip plugging structure can be reused, and the construction efficiency is improved. The detachable post-pouring strip plugging structure comprises a plurality of steel bars forming a post-pouring strip, wherein the steel bars are distributed vertically and horizontally and are bound at the intersection, two ends of the post-pouring strip are of poured coagulation structures, steel wire nets are arranged on two sides in a post-pouring strip area, a template is arranged on one side of each steel wire net, square timber is arranged on the outer side of the upper end of each template and above the steel wire net, steel plates are arranged above the square timber and the templates, and handles are arranged on the upper surfaces of the steel plates. Further, the square timber and the templates are fixed by screws with the steel plate, and the handles are fixed on the surface of the steel plate by screws. Further, the steel plate, the square timber and the templates are fixedly connected into an integrated structure. And the bottom ends of the post-pouring belt and the two-end coagulation structures are provided with concrete cushion layers. Further, the template is provided with a clamping groove penetrating through the reinforcing steel bars. Compared with the prior art, the utility model has the beneficial effects that: According to the utility model, square timber is arranged above the steel wire mesh and at one side of the upper end of the template, so that the side surface is smooth and attractive when cement is poured, and the later manual treatment is avoided; The steel plate, the square timber, the templates and the handles are fixedly connected into an integrated structure and can be disassembled, the parts of the steel plate, the square timber and the templates are all lifted out when the mold is disassembled, and the integrated structure can be repeatedly and circularly utilized when being applied to other post-cast strip areas because the sizes of the post-cast strip areas are almost consistent, so that the time required for reinstallation is reduced, and the construction efficiency is improved.
